最有價值的會議及memset易錯提醒

2021-08-15 15:39:51 字數 639 閱讀 6757

本文提要:在用malloc開闢空間時,若要用memset清空或者賦初值,不能直接套用memset(p,0,sizeof(p));(p是指標)而應先確定需要的大小n,用memset(p,0,n*sizeof(p));(詳細原因可見本下文)

/*動態規劃的題目:給定不同會議的時間及其價值(會議時間會有重疊,已按結束時間公升序排序),選定總價值之和最高的會議,且同一時間只能進行一場會議*/

#include

#include//前面忘記這個標頭檔案,謝謝提醒@weixin_40215561

#include

#define n 100

struct t

meet[n];

int solve_dp(int n);

int max(int x,int y);

int max(int x,int y)

int solve_dp(int n)

int *opt = malloc((n+1)*sizeof(int));

opt[1] = meet[1].value;

for(i = 2; i<=n; i++)

return opt[n];

}int main()

最有價值的程式設計忠告

發表於 2012 08 20 09 15 17849次閱讀 aqee 佚名研發實踐 gounix 結對程式設計 程式語言 摘要 本文是來自貝爾實驗室plan 9作業系統的創始人rob pike給大家分享的程式設計忠告!rob pike,目前谷歌公司最著名的軟體工程師之一,曾是貝爾實驗室unix開發團...

最有價值的程式設計忠告

rob pike,目前谷歌公司最著名的軟體工程師之一,曾是貝爾實驗室unix開發團隊成員,plan9作業系統開發的主要領導人,inferno作業系統開發的主要領導人。他是締造go語言和limbo語言的核心人物。下面是他分享給大家他在貝爾實驗室工作的一段經歷,這段經歷改變了他對bug除錯的思想認識。j...

最有價值的社交方式

與聰明人聊天,同靠譜人做事 有些人,很討人喜歡,但不能深交,尤其不能共事。剛認識,你覺得天吶天吶,怎麼有這麼可愛的人,幾件事情過後,就成了天吶天吶,怎麼有這麼不靠譜的人。可愛是他們的通行證,得到好感太容易,住住就忽視了專業魅力的培養。與聰明的人聊天,與靠譜的人做事 能因為喜歡你,而容忍你的不靠譜的人...